STIC LogoThe Smalltalk Industry Council is a cohesive Smalltalk community where information, technical issues, new ideas and concerns are openly discussed to benefit the industry. STIC members are users and vendors of Smalltalk tools, components, databases and services.

Allen B. Davis – Smalltalk Industry Council:

"Smalltalk is by far the best programming language available. The Family of C programming languages has been evolving toward Smalltalk-like functionality for the past 25 years. Java is the most Smalltalk-like of the C family, removing the direct pointer manipulation of C++ and adding fully integrated garbage collection. Smalltalk provides a simpler syntax, consistency between class and instance behavior, much higher productivity and easier maintainability. This makes it the logical next choice for current Java developers and the logical choice for businesses interested in reducing their total cost of ownership for software systems. Smalltalk is well supported by many vendors including Cincom, IBM and Instantiations”

STIC is a nonprofit trade association whose goal is to promote the awareness of and increase demand for Smalltalk by:

  • Promoting Smalltalk as the programming language of choice for application development in the business world.
  • Listening and responding to the needs of the Smalltalk business community.
  • Creating a focal point to distribute the latest information on Smalltalk.
  • Encouraging the participation of all segments of the Smalltalk industry including vendors, service providers, and users.
  • Encouraging additional standards for Smalltalk.
